What companies run services between Biñan, Philippines and Philippine Orthopedic Center, Philippines?

You can take a bus from Biñan to Philippine Orthopedic Center via Buendia Bus Terminal, Taft Ave, Lungsod ng Pasay, and Community Centre, San Isidro Labrador, Quezon City in around 2h 5m. Alternatively, Philippine National Railways operates a train from Pacita Complex to España once daily. Tickets cost ₱25–45 and the journey takes 1h 35m.
